Names Of Queen Band Members

Names Of Queen Band Members are 1. Freddie Mercury 2. Brian May 3. Roger Taylor, and 4. John Deacon. The four have sold more than 300 million records worldwide.
Initially known as Smile, a progressive rock band, May and Taylor welcomed Mercury as their lead singer in April 1970.
The latter made significant changes in their early band and experimented with musical genres. They later recruited Deacon in February 1971, and the quartet released their self-titled debut album two years later.
Since then, Queen evolved as one of the top best rock bands in the world.
Meanwhile, their songs We Will Rock You, and We Are the Champions have become almost compulsory sporting anthems globally. The sparks around the band still shine bright, despite going through unfortunate events.

Queen Original Band Members
The four original member lineups of Queen remain a legendary quartet in music's history. Here is a table of their roles in the group:
Band Members | Role in the Band |
Freddie Mercury | vocals, piano, keyboards |
Brian May | guitars, vocals, keyboards |
Roger Taylor | drums, vocals, percussion, guitars, keyboards |
John Deacon | bass guitar, guitars, keyboards, backing vocals |
Freddie Mercury
Mercury was the one who renamed Smile to Queen. He sang, played piano and introduced the idea of making music around elaborate stage and recording techniques.
Today, he is considered to be few of the best rock music vocalists who lived in the history of music.
His iconic extrovert and flamboyant on-stage appearance made him a global icon. The memories of his style at the Queen's Live Aid concert at Wembley in 1985 still remains fresh among everyone.
Music critics and audiences praise Mercury for his four-octave vocal range. Meanwhile, his exceptional quality in delivering the best vocals during live shows is still considered to be unmatchable.
Brian May
May is the lead guitarist of Queen and remains in the same position. He is a regular songwriter for the band but has ceased to compose new music.
As a guitarist, he is considered to be one of the best in the world. Besides making music, Brian is a certified astrophysicist and an animal rights activist.
King Charles III knighted him in the 2023 New Year Honours for his services to music and charity, per The Economic Times.
Roger Taylor
Taylor and May are the founding members of the Smile-turned Queen band. They had been making music for two years before Freddie joined the band.
He is also considered to be one of the world's greatest drummers, as his skills exceed that of a normal drummer.
Roger also contributed to Queen's songs on each album, just like other members. He and May are the only active members of this rock band.
John Deacon
Deacon contributed to bass for Queen and was known as the quiet member. The reason is that he mainly avoided speaking, let alone discussing and arguing.
Despite his shy and quiet demeanor, he worked as a skilled bassist for the Queen and became just the right bassist.
John retired in 1997 and remains away from the limelight even as of 2023.
Queen Band Members Now
Queen hit rock bottom when they lost Freddie Mercury to AIDS complications on November 24, 1991. The band did not remain the same since then.
Mercury was diagnosed with the disease in 1987 but continued to record with Queen. His final statement on his health was released only a day before his demise.
His bandmates came together for The Freddie Mercury Tribute Concert for AIDS Awareness in April 1991, remembering him.
But after this tribute, the remaining trio parted ways, with May and Roger becoming active members. The duo continues to raise Queen's legacy with concerts and featured artists.
Queen Band Members Still Alive
Brian May travels far and wide for live shows. He experienced a small heart attack in May 2020 but has continued his career.
Drummer Roger Taylor made headlines in October 2021 when he went on a solo music tour. The 14 shows tour was around the UK, which he managed alongside his ongoing tour.
Queen's former bassist, John Deacon, was so heartbroken about Freddie's passing away that he quit the band. He cut off his career and contact with the media.
The duo of May and Taylor continued maintaining contact with him, which was severed over time. Besides financial matters regarding the band, John lives away from the turmoil of facing the world.
He lives in Putney in southwest London with his wife.

Is The Band Queen Still Performing?
Queen band is still performing as of 2023 though the only members are May and Taylor. However, their work is limited to stage and live shows.
The band's last album release was in 1995, with Made in Heaven being their last creation. The album also features Freddie posthumously.
After his demise and Deacon's retirement, the remaining two continued the legacy of Queen through concert tours. They initiated their first tour in 2005 in collaboration with Paul Rodgers.
The list below includes all of the Queen's tours after their last album:
- Queen + Paul Rodgers Tour (2005–2006)
- Rock the Cosmos Tour (2008)
- Queen + Adam Lambert Tour (2012)
- Queen + Adam Lambert Tour (2014–2015)
- Queen + Adam Lambert 2016 Summer Festival Tour (2016)
- Queen + Adam Lambert Tour 2017–2018)
- The Rhapsody Tou (2019–2023)
May and Taylor's professional bond with The Firm's Rodgers ended in 2009, and they joined hands with Adam Lambert in 2011. As both play instruments, their two partners are vocalists.
This talented trio is supported by equally experienced and gifted musicians. The list below shows the instrumentalist's names and their roles during the concerts:
- Spike Edney – keyboards, rhythm guitar, backing vocals
- Neil Fairclough – bass, backing vocals
- Tyler Warren – percussion, drums, backing vocals
Edney has been touring with the remaining Queen members since 1984. Fairclough joined the team in 2011, followed by Warren in 2017.
Who Is The Lead Singer of Queen Now?
Queen does not have a lead singer as of 2023. May and Taylor have confirmed that no one would replace the late Freddie as a lead vocalist.
For their tours, vocalist Adam Lambert sings on stage due to his partnership with the remaining Queen duo. Their team is called Queen + Adam Lambert.
The trio is also written as Q+AL or QAL. Here, Lambert is rather a featured artist than a replacement for Freddie.
Q+AL got together in May 2011 and has gone on five tours since then. Their ongoing tour is named The Rhapsody Tour, which started on July 10, 2019.
It will end on November 12, 2023, with the last concert set in BMO Stadium, Los Angeles. It contains four legs around North America, Europe, Oceania, and Asia.
May, Taylor, and Lambert will finish a total of 109 shows where the latter is the singer.
